Leidos is an American technology and engineering services company created in 2013 when Science Applications International Corporation split in two, with Leidos taking the technical services and solutions business. It is one of the largest suppliers to the United States government, working across defence programmes, intelligence systems, civil agencies including the Federal Aviation Administration, and healthcare services for the Department of Veterans Affairs. Headquartered in Reston, Virginia, the company also builds security detection products for airports and borders, and has concentrated recent investment on trusted artificial intelligence and autonomy for mission environments.

Leidos’ NISC IV program seeks a Radio Frequency Engineer/Spectrum Engineer to support the FAA Spectrum Engineering Services Group (AJW-194) within the area of National Defense and Electronic Attack.

The ideal candidate will have experience in radio frequency (RF) engineering, spectrum coordination, spectrum management, frequency coordination, frequency management, and/or tactical communication systems. Experience with Joint Tactical Information Distribution System (JTIDS), Multifunctional Information Distribution System (MIDS), and Link-16 preferred but not required.

Link-16/JTIDS/MIDS Spectrum Engineer - Primary Responsibilities:

  • Link-16 Spectrum Engineering Analysis: Perform RF spectrum engineering and technical analysis and interagency frequency coordination in support of Joint Tactical Information Distribution System (JTIDS), Multifunctional Information Distribution System (MIDS), and Link-16 operations to identify and mitigate potential impacts on FAA systems and the National Airspace (NAS).

  • DoD/FAA Spectrum Coordination: Serve as a technical coordination point between DoD and FAA stakeholders for military Link-16 testing, exercises, and operations.

  • TFA & QTTR Processing: Review and analyze Department of Defense (DoD) Temporary Frequency Authorization (TFA), Quick Turn Test Request (QTTR), and Link-16 usage notifications to identify potential impacts to FAA systems, operations, and spectrum equities.

  • FAA Concurrence Development: Prepare engineering recommendations and concurrence packages documenting FAA conditions, restrictions, or mitigation requirements necessary to protect FAA systems and the National Airspace System (NAS).

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or of Science degree in Electrical Engineering or similar technical equivalent, completion of a formal spectrum management course, or relevant military experience.

  • 2+ years of relevant experience in RF/spectrum engineering,EMI/EMC and interference analysis,RF propagation/modeling and geospatial analysis, and/or federal frequency coordination/spectrum management.

  • Experience conducting propagation modeling, link-budget analysis, and elect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) analyses.

  • Proficient in the use of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int).

  • Ability to learn FAA-specific software and systems.

  • Must be a U.S. citizenship.

  • Must possess and maintain a DoD Secret security clearance or able to obtain a DoD Secret clearance.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with: Link-16/JTIDS/MIDS, Tactical Data Links (TDL), Joint Electromagnetic Spectrum Operations (JEMSO), Electromagnetic Spectrum Management Operations, Electronic Warfare, Command and Control (C2), Air Defense, and/or federal frequency coordination/spectrum management.

  • Experience evaluating radio-frequency system parameters to identify and mitigate potential interference and resolving routine and complex spectrum-engineering problems.

  • Knowledge of roles and responsibilities of spectrum management within the National Airspace System (NAS).

  • Knowledge of and experience with various frequency policy organizations, including National Telecommunications and Information Administration (NTIA), Interdepartmental Radio Advisory Committee (IRAC), and associated sub-committees, and the Federal Communications Commission (FCC).
